Output ebde7423b33e101c4991701dfcd40777e08db95627af170b571bd7bc7047556c:25

value
260224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d16e5399234861faf78a043f6fe54a8a654d17a9 OP_EQUAL
address
3LnPKG28BRvHEn4X8LohHozV4GnF7ucsTE
transaction
ebde7423b33e101c4991701dfcd40777e08db95627af170b571bd7bc7047556c